**BREAKING: NFL Takes Unprecedented Action Against Referees — A New Era of Accountability**

In a shocking move that has sent shockwaves through the NFL, the league has fired three officials and reassigned them to work in college football conferences. This unprecedented decision highlights the NFL’s renewed focus on accountability and performance metrics in officiating.

### **The Decision: A Shift Toward Accountability**

The three officials involved are second-year umpire James Carter, third-year line judge Robin DeLorenzo, and first-year down judge Robert Richeson. Typically, dismissed NFL officials are free to seek new officiating jobs on their own. However, in a bold departure from tradition, the NFL has offered these officials a chance to continue their careers in the Power 5 college conferences.

This move follows a postseason marked by several high-profile officiating controversies, prompting calls for greater accountability within the officiating community. The NFL’s Vice President of Officiating Training and Development, Ramon George, emphasized the use of data analysis to evaluate officials’ performance, signaling a shift toward a more performance-driven culture.
